What is Heart Failure? Causes, Symptoms, Risk, Treatment

One in every five heart attack patients is now under the age of 40. Heart attacks are becoming more common in people in their 30s and 40s due to lifestyle factors, diet, and genetic issues. Increased stress is another risk factor that has become a major cause of heart attacks, particularly during this pandemic.

Not everyone experiences the same level of severity of symptoms. However, warning symptoms may appear hours, days, or weeks before the event. Angina (chest pain) is the first and most common symptom, which can be brought on by exertion and relieved by rest.

Some common symptoms of heart attack are

·        Pressure, tightness, or pain in the chest or arms spreading to the neck, back, or jaw

·        Abdominal pain, nausea, and indigestion

·        Dizziness and fatigue

·        Breathing difficulty

·        Cold sweat

Certain factors may play a key role in a person's development of heart disease. Some are curable and controllable, while others are not. Some risk factors are inherited (hereditary), while others are caused by a sedentary lifestyle. Some of the most common risk factors for heart attacks include high blood pressure, obesity, cholesterol, smoking, and tobacco use.

A healthy lifestyle can help us reduce the risk of heart attack. Healthy heart habits include:

·        A heart-friendly diet and a reduction in processed food intake

·        Daily exercise and optimal physical activity

·        Avoiding tobacco use in any form

·        Reduction in alcohol consumption

·        Routine preventive health check-ups

·        Stress reduction through yoga and other recreational activities.

·        Aware with the signs and symptoms of heart disease.
